What Business Owners Should Look For in an AI Logo Tool
Not all AI logo platforms are the same. Some focus on quick logo generation, while others provide complete brand kits, social media templates, business cards, and website assets. The best choice depends on the owner’s goals, budget, and level of design control required.
Important features usually include:
- Customization options: The platform should allow changes to colors, fonts, icons, layouts, and spacing.
- File formats: Professional use requires high-resolution files, preferably including SVG, PNG, PDF, and transparent background versions.
- Brand kit support: Many businesses benefit from matching social media graphics, letterheads, and presentation templates.
- Commercial usage rights: Owners should review licensing terms before using a logo publicly.
- Scalability: A logo should look clear on both a small mobile screen and a large sign.
- Ease of use: A good tool should guide non-designers through the branding process without overwhelming them.
Looka
Looka is one of the most recognized AI logo design platforms for entrepreneurs and small businesses. It asks users to enter a company name, select visual preferences, choose colors, and identify industry categories. The system then produces a range of logo concepts that can be customized further.
Its main strength is its brand kit functionality. Beyond logos, Looka can generate matching business cards, social media profiles, email signatures, and other branded materials. This makes it useful for owners who want a consistent visual identity across several channels without hiring multiple designers.
Looka is especially popular among service providers, consultants, ecommerce brands, and early-stage startups. However, business owners should still take time to adjust generic-looking layouts and avoid choosing designs that resemble common templates too closely.

Hatchful by Shopify
Hatchful, created by Shopify, is a logo maker especially useful for ecommerce entrepreneurs. It allows business owners to choose an industry, select a visual style, and generate logo options suited to online stores, product brands, and digital storefronts.
One of its biggest advantages is simplicity. Hatchful is designed for fast use, making it helpful for owners who need a logo quickly for a Shopify store, marketplace profile, or social media launch. It can also provide logo variations sized for different online platforms.
Hatchful may not offer the deepest customization capabilities compared with some paid platforms, but it remains popular because it is quick, accessible, and aligned with ecommerce branding needs.
Fiverr Logo Maker
Fiverr Logo Maker combines automated logo generation with the creative work of freelance designers. Instead of relying entirely on generic AI output, it uses designs created by human designers and adapts them based on the business owner’s inputs.
This hybrid model can be attractive because it blends speed with a more designer-led foundation. Business owners can generate options quickly and, in many cases, connect with freelancers for further customization if needed.
It is a good option for companies that want something faster than a custom design project but more curated than a fully automated logo maker. Owners should still review licensing, customization limits, and whether additional edits require extra fees.
Generative AI Tools for Logo Concepts
Some business owners also experiment with generative AI image tools such as DALL-E, Midjourney, or similar platforms to explore logo ideas. These tools can produce imaginative concepts from text prompts, making them useful for brainstorming visual directions.
However, generative AI image tools are not always ideal for final logo files. They may produce raster images rather than clean vector artwork, and text rendering can be inconsistent. For this reason, businesses often use these platforms during the concept stage, then recreate the chosen direction in a proper logo design tool or with a designer.
This approach can be effective when a company wants inspiration before committing to a final design. It allows rapid exploration of themes, moods, symbols, and visual metaphors.

Limitations and Risks to Consider
Despite their usefulness, AI logo tools have limitations. The most common issue is lack of uniqueness. Since many platforms use templates, icons, and common design formulas, some logos may look similar to others in the same industry.
Another concern is strategic depth. A logo is not only decoration; it should reflect positioning, audience expectations, competitive differentiation, and long-term business goals. AI can suggest attractive visuals, but it may not fully understand the emotional and market context behind a brand.
Business owners should also check whether the logo is suitable for trademark registration. Some AI-generated designs may use common symbols or stock-like elements that are difficult to protect legally. When trademark protection is important, professional legal and design review is recommended.

Best Practices for Using AI Logo Makers
Business owners can improve results by approaching AI logo design thoughtfully. Instead of entering a company name and accepting the first attractive design, they should prepare a short brand brief. This brief may include the target audience, desired personality, competitor examples, preferred colors, and words the brand should evoke.
It is also wise to test logo options in real-world settings. A design that looks good on a white preview screen may not work well on packaging, signage, mobile apps, uniforms, or social media icons. Owners should preview the logo at different sizes and against different backgrounds.
Finally, feedback matters. Showing the top logo choices to trusted customers, employees, or advisors can reveal whether the design communicates the intended message. The most effective AI-assisted logos usually result from a mix of machine-generated ideas and human judgment.

What file format is best for a business logo?
SVG is often best for scalability, while PNG is useful for digital use with transparent backgrounds. Professional logo packages may also include PDF, EPS, and high-resolution image files.
